The two main groups at war in Syria are the military, loyal to embattled Syrian President Bashar al-Assad, and a loosely-linked network of rebel fighters who are tentatively agreeing to a truce.
The deal was brokered by the United States and Russia. Russian leader Vladimir Putin says this is a real chance to stop the bloodshed – and a chance to get aid.
